Democrat Ron Barber raised almost $550,000 in the first seven weeks of his campaign to finish the term of former Rep Gabrielle Giffords (D-Ariz.), his campaign announced Thursday.

Advertisement

Barber’s campaign said 3,293 individuals had pitched in since he announced in February his campaign for the special election.

"I believe that fundraising isn’t just about the bottom line — it’s about people investing in someone they know will stand up for their values,” Barber said in a statement.
